  5. Metal Gear series reaches 31 million worldwide

    Quote Originally Posted by wraggster View Post
    Konami's tentpole franchise is still moving copies off shelves
    Konami has announced that the Metal Gear series has sold 31 million copies worldwide as of December 31, 2011. The original Metal Gear was released in 1987 for the Japanese MSX2 hardware.
